Romelu Lukaku has declared the decision over his contract has already been made and refused to comment further on his Everton future.


The Lukaku interview on SSN. this makes me think he's staying… pic.twitter.com/XryeR7ty9l

— USM Wayne Thompson❄ (@waynethompson73) March 24, 2017

Lukaku, who is preparing for Belgium’s World Cup qualifier at home to Greece on Saturday evening made no apologies for talking up his own ambitions: “I’ve made a long way until now but the road is still long and I know I have to improve and get better. I want to help Everton as much as I can, as well as the national team. I think a lot of stuff can be achieved.

“Yes. There is nothing wrong with ambition. You have to embrace it and where you are as a footballer.

“The decision has already been made so I can’t talk about that.”

Martin O’Neill described Séamus Coleman’s broken leg as a huge blow to the Republic of Ireland and Everton after the right-back suffered a horrific injury that overshadowed the goalless draw against Wales. Neil Taylor received a straight red card for the reckless challenge that led to Coleman leaving the field on a stretcher and being taken to hospital.

Taylor tried to apologise to Coleman after the game but the Ireland defender had already left the stadium.
